Freigeben über


Word.ExportOptimizeFor enum

Gibt das Optimierungsziel für den Dokumentexport an.

Hinweise

[ API-Satz: WordApiDesktop 1.4 ]

Beispiele

// Link to full sample: https://raw.githubusercontent.com/OfficeDev/office-js-snippets/prod/samples/word/99-preview-apis/export.yaml

await Word.run(async (context) => {
  const document: Word.Document = context.document;

  // Export the current document as a PDF saved in your default location, usually Documents.
  const filename = `exported-doc-${getCurrentDate()}.pdf`;
  console.log(`File name: ${filename}`);
  const options: Word.DocumentExportAsFixedFormatOptions = {
    item: Word.ExportItem.documentContent,
    openAfterExport: true,
    optimizeFor: Word.ExportOptimizeFor.onScreen,
  };

  // If a file with the same name already exists at the default location, it's silently overwritten.
  document.exportAsFixedFormat(filename, Word.ExportFormat.pdf, options);

  await context.sync();
});

Felder

onScreen = "OnScreen"

Optimiert für die Bildschirmanzeige.

print = "Print"

Optimiert für den Druck.